Understanding the Problem: Why Bathrooms Get Cold
Before diving into solutions, let's understand why bathrooms are particularly susceptible to cold temperatures. Several factors contribute:
- Poor Insulation: Bathrooms often have less insulation than other rooms, leading to heat loss through walls and floors.
- Ventilation: Essential for preventing mold and mildew, bathroom ventilation fans can quickly exhaust warm air.
- Exposure: Bathrooms located on exterior walls are more prone to cold drafts.
- Tile and Stone: These common bathroom materials are naturally cold to the touch.
Simple & Affordable Ways to Warm Your Bathroom
These quick fixes can significantly improve your bathroom's temperature without breaking the bank:
1. Close the Bathroom Door & Vent
This might seem obvious, but ensuring the bathroom door remains closed when not in use helps trap existing heat. Similarly, turn off the exhaust fan as soon as you finish showering to prevent warm air from escaping.
2. Utilize a Heated Towel Rail
Heated towel rails are stylish and practical. They gently warm towels, providing a cozy feel and adding a touch of warmth to the room itself. Consider electric or hydronic models depending on your plumbing setup.
3. Embrace Rugs
Placing rugs on the bathroom floor significantly reduces the chill from cold tiles. Choose thick, plush rugs for maximum warmth. Consider using a bathmat in front of the shower/tub as well.
4. Install a Shower Curtain Liner
A thick, insulated shower curtain liner helps prevent heat loss during showers. Look for liners specifically designed to retain heat.
5. Add a Space Heater
Portable electric space heaters provide instant warmth. Choose a model with safety features like overheat protection and tip-over switches. Remember to never leave a space heater unattended.
More Involved Solutions for Long-Term Warmth
For a more permanent solution, consider these options:
1. Improve Bathroom Insulation
This is a more substantial undertaking, often involving adding insulation to walls and floors. Professional insulation can significantly reduce heat loss and improve energy efficiency. This investment pays for itself over time.
2. Upgrade to a More Efficient Ventilation System
If your ventilation fan is constantly exhausting heat, consider upgrading to a model with a humidity sensor. This ensures the fan only runs when necessary, minimizing heat loss.
3. Install Underfloor Heating
Underfloor heating systems, whether electric or hydronic, provide luxurious warmth directly underfoot. This is a more expensive solution but offers unparalleled comfort and efficiency.
4. Consider a Bathroom Remodeling
If your bathroom is significantly cold, a full remodel might be necessary. This allows you to address insulation, ventilation, and material choices simultaneously for optimal warmth.
Maintaining Bathroom Warmth: Tips & Tricks
- Regularly clean your ventilation system: A clogged ventilation system can reduce its efficiency.
- Seal any drafts: Use caulk or weatherstripping to seal any gaps around windows, doors, or plumbing fixtures.
- Consider the location of your thermostat: If your thermostat is not located in the bathroom, it may not accurately reflect the bathroom's temperature.
